Imagine two corporations are competing in the same market. The inferior company will always try to either copy the successful strategies of the winner or to learn from the mistakes the other corporation is making. A lot of 2nd runners in this corporation races have as their mission statement that they want to bring down the market leader. Which, if we think about it, gives off a fragrance of defeatism and olderbrother-younger brother syndrome.

Because there is some weird safety on being the loser. On being the underdog. On being the follower. On being the one who reacts. On being the one who needs to mirror the other individual.

Because by being all these, you inadvertently or willingly remove the initiative of being the winner. You just want to be a moral loser.

Failure has definitely some weird safety around it.
